Position Overview Under the general direction of the Manager Allied Health and the Manager, Health Services, the incumbent is responsible for providing quality Respiratory Therapy services. The Respiratory Therapist collaborates with clients to provide therapeutic, diagnostic, technical and teaching services consistent with discipline and professional standards. Quality client care is supported through continuing professional development, research, quality improvement and promotion of respiratory therapy.

The Respiratory Therapist demonstrates a commitment to the vision, values, goals, and objectives of the region and Riverview Health Centre. Experience

Recent and relevant clinical experience preferred.

Education (Degree/Diploma/Certificate)

Degree/diploma in Respiratory Therapy or equivalent education as recognized by the Manitoba Association of Registered Respiratory Therapists (MARRT).

Certification/Licensure/Registration

Current registration with the MARRT required. Current registration/membership in the Canadian Society of Respiratory Therapists (CSRT) is required or an equivalent, as determined by the employer, for therapists not eligible for CSRT registration. Current certification in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) provider level.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ation (CPR) training requirements for this position shall be in accordance with the Employer policy.

Physical Requirements

  • Ability to stand and walk and perform manual ventilation with one or both hands for prolonged periods.
  • Ability to run to emergencies.
  • Ability to lift heavy medical equipment including measuring devices, monitors, gas cylinders and other equipment (weighing up to 15 pounds/6.8 kg).
  • Ability to push wheeled medical equipment.
  • Ability to move H and M size gas cylinders (weighing 66 to 100 pounds/30 to 45.5 kg).
  • Ability to assist with the positioning of clients.
